Abstract

A reconfigurable antenna is arranged on one surface of a substrate and comprises a plurality of radiating bodies and a control circuit. The radiating bodies comprise a centre radiating body and a plurality of outer radiating bodies distributed in a regular geometrical shape with the centre radiating body as the center, and the control circuit is arranged among the radiating bodies and controls reconstruction of gains of the radiating bodies. The control circuit controls the radiating bodies so that electromagnetic radiation fields of the radiating bodies can be changed, frequency recombination and gain recombination are achieved, the antenna can be controlled through control signals to reduce frequency bands of the antenna and increase gains of certain frequency bands, and the antenna is cheap and easy to manufacture; obvious technical and cost advantages are achieved, the gains can be reconstructed when weak signals are caught, and reception capacity is enhanced.

Description

technical field [0001] The invention belongs to the communication field, and in particular relates to a reconfigurable antenna and a system thereof. Background technique [0002] As a component used to transmit or receive radio waves, the antenna plays a pivotal role in the wireless communication system and is an indispensable part of the wireless communication system. With the rapid development of high-frequency satellite communication systems, radar, wireless communication systems, especially the construction of global 3G and 4G networks, the requirements for antennas are getting higher and higher. On the one hand, the antenna needs to be able to work in multiple frequency bands, have multiple working modes and have good transmission performance. On the other hand, it is necessary to reduce the weight of the antenna, reduce the volume of the antenna and reduce the cost.
